2) Trace Point Setup
This sets the timing to collect trace data. Select one from the following:
• Each Scan
Collects trace data for every scan (END processing).
• Interval
Collects trace data at specified times.
• Detailed
Sets the device and step no. The setting method and trace data sampling
timing is the same as mentioned in section Section 6.11.1, (when setting
the monitor condition.)
The devices that can be set in the detailed condition are as follows:
•Bit Device
: X, Y, M, L, F, SM, V, B, SB, T(contact), ST(contact),
•Word Device : T(current value), ST(current value),C(current value), D,
The following attributes can be set for the above devices:
•Bit device number of digits specification
•Word device bit number specification
3) Trigger Point setup
This sets the point to execute the trigger. Select one from the following:
• At the time of TRACE order:
The time of execution of TRACE instruction is set as the trigger.
• At the time of trigger operation:
The trigger operation from GX Developer device is set as the trigger.
• Detailed setting
The device and step number is set. The setting method and trigger
execution timing is the same as mentioned in Section 6.11.1., (the monitor
condition setting.)
4) Trace additional information
The information to be added for every trace is set. Multiple items can be
selected from the following (of none of the items have to be selected):
• Time
Stores the time when the trace was executed.
• Step No.
Stores the step number when the trace was executed.
• Program Name
Stores the program name that executed the trace.
